Prime Minister Narendra Modi is in Laos to attend the 14th ASEAN-India and the 11th East Asia Summit.

On Thursday, Modi will hold several bilateral parleys including a meeting with US President Barack Obama of the on the sidelines of the summit. Regional and multilateral issues are likely to be discussed by the two leaders.
Modi already met and held talks with host-nation premier Thongloun Sisoulith, South Korean president Park Geun-hye and Myanmar's State Counsellor Aung Sang Suu Kyi.
The PM held extensive bilateral meeting with his Japanese counterpart Shinzo Abe on Wednesday. India and Japan pledged to further strengthen cooperation in the area of counter terrorism, trade and investments.
